lib/debugfs: Add igt_assert_crc_equal
Because of hash collisions tests should only ever compare crc
checksums for equality. Checking for inequality can result in random
failures.
To ensure this only expose and igt_assert function and use that.
Follow-up patches will rework the code for tests which don't follow
this requirement and try to compare for CRC inequality.
